I'm in the planning stages of building a cmoy and have a couple of questions regarding the build and modification to best suit my needs.

I will mainly be driving IEM's with the cmoy with my 4g Ipod Nano as a source (using the line out, not the 3.5 headphone jack).

1st Question: Is there any effect of using 1/2W or 1W resistors over the 1/4W resistors or should I stick to what is recommend on the tangentsoft site?

2nd Question: I would like to run my cmoy using a 11.1v Lithium Polymer battery pack.

My passion and also my work is in the hobby industry, I deal with lipo packs on almost a daily basis and also own all the correct safety and balance charging equipment needed.

I understand that I would need to create a voltage cut-off circuit for this to work, and that is no trouble.

What I need to know is are there any modifications I need to make to the cmoy's power supply in order to make the lipo battery source work correctly, or can I stick exactly to tangent's schematics? I am not 100% sure if I need to change the resistors in the virtual ground circuit or not.

1: Stick with the smaller resistors (1/8 W - 1/4 W) as the CMoY doesn't consume much current. Larger resistors are of no benefit, other than being physically larger, and more expensive. If you want to get fancy use 1% tolerance metal film resistors, like Vishay Dale RN Series.

2: Depends on the Op-Amp you use, but I recall the limit being fairly high. I built a DC adapter to supply 19 V to mine.

1) You'll have a difficult time getting 1/2 or 1W resistors to fit the ratshack board without lots of creative lead bending. Larger wattage resistors supposedly have slightly lower noise figures than smaller, but you won't hear any benefit here.

2) The lipo pack will give you ~+/- 5.5Vdc, so no problem. The exisiting virtual ground should be fine, or a TLE2426 for VG would also be fine, or really any VG improvements on Tangents site. Most common audio opamps will go to +/-12Vdc, with many doing +/-15V and higher. Some opamps intentionally made for portable applications will have lower PS ratings.

I would lower the gain to 2 or so if IEMs are your intended application.
